When designing a commercial cafe, breakroom or lunchroom, understanding the types of seating available can enhance both the aesthetic and functional elements of the space. Each type of seating plays a specific role in customer experience and business operations. Here, we’ll explore the various options and their distinct features.

Types of Cafe Seating:

1. Traditional Cafe Chairs and Tables:

This classic choice provides flexibility and accommodates various group sizes. Available in a range of materials like wood, metal, and plastic, they can fit diverse design themes. They are ideal for maximizing space and maintaining an organized layout.

2. Booth Cafe Seating:
Popular for its privacy and comfort, booth seating encourages customers to stay longer. It typically consists of a bench seat with a high back, often lined against a wall. Booths work well in cafes that aim to create intimate, cozy settings.

3. Banquette Seating:
Similar to booth seating, banquettes offer a continuous seating arrangement, often along a wall. They maximize space efficiently and are perfect for smaller or narrow cafes. Banquettes can also serve as a design focal point with creative upholstery.

4. Bar Stools and Counters:
Bar stools paired with high counters are excellent for quick service environments or cafes with limited space. They promote a casual atmosphere and are great for patrons on the go. This setup is often found near windows or central areas, encouraging interact
ion.

5. Communal Tables:
Designed to seat multiple guests together, communal tables or a cafe bench foster a social environment and are great for larger groups or events. They often become the hub of activity in cafes, encouraging interaction among patrons.

6. Outdoor Cafe Seating:
Patios or sidewalk seating extend the cafe’s space and attract more customers, particularly in pleasant weather. Outdoor furniture must be durable and weather-resistant, combining functionality with aesthetic appeal.

7. Lounge Cafe Seating:
Incorporating sofas or armchairs, lounge seating provides a relaxed, comfortable experience. It’s ideal for cafes looking to create a cozy atmosphere where customers can linger, read, or work.

8. Modular Cafe  Seating:

This versatile option allows for customizable arrangements, adapting to different group sizes and layouts. It’s particularly useful in dynamic spaces that require frequent reconfiguration for events or peak times.

Each type of cafe seating not only serves a practical purpose but also contributes to the overall ambiance and brand identity of the cafe. By carefully selecting and arranging these options, cafe owners can enhance customer satisfaction and optimize their space effectively.
